What is Colyte? Colyte is a bowel cleansing product used to cleanse the bowel prior to colonoscopy. The “jug” is mixed with one gallon of water (4 liters). You will begin bowel preparation the evening before and finish by early morning of the procedure. In most cases, a clear liquid diet is required the day before.

Feb 23, · Colonoscopy is a procedure that enables an examiner (usually a gastroenterologist) to evaluate the inside of the colon (large intestine or large bowel). The colonoscope is a four-foot long, flexible tube about the thickness of a finger with a camera and a source of light at its tip. The tip of the colonoscope is inserted into the anus and then is .
